How they compare

Greece currently reports 23.82 % change on previous year against 3.98 % change on previous year in High income, a difference of 19.84 % change on previous year.

That makes Greece's figure about 6.0 times High income's.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Greece ahead.

Greece ranks 22nd and High income ranks 20th of 198 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Greece averaged higher in 2 and High income in 1.
